Product: The Sims 4
Platform:PC
Which language are you playing the game in? English
How often does the bug occur? Every time (100%)
What is your current game version number? 1.73.57.1030
What expansions, game packs, and stuff packs do you have installed? All.
Steps: How can we find the bug ourselves? Have a Sim ask a Sim with the Hates Children trait to Try for Baby; repeat with the Hates Children Sim in the Dazed mood.
What happens when the bug occurs? The Hates Children Sim will (sometimes) agree to Try for Baby while in the Dazed mood.
What do you expect to see? I realize that this is intended behavior, and not a bug. However, this aspect of the Hates Children trait seems to echo serious real-life issues a bit too closely. While I'm certain this was not the intention, it feels as though The Sims 4 has added elements of date * by allowing a Sim to convince a Sim who does not want kids to try for a baby if the Sim is intoxicated (in the Dazed mood). I just don't feel like complicated issues of consent while intoxicated belong in The Sims 4.
Have you installed any customization with the game, e.g. Custom Content or Mods? Not now. I've removed them.
Did this issue appear after a specific patch or change you made to your system? Yes
Please describe the patch or change you made. I believe this aspect of the Hates Children trait was added in the 3/23/21 patch.

Again, I understand that this is not a bug, but I think this aspect of the Hates Children trait should be reconsidered.

Nice sly edit EA:

 

Hates Children     

Sims with the Hates Children trait are very unreceptive to being asked to ‘Try for Baby’.

 

https://www.ea.com/games/the-sims/the-sims-4/amp/news/sims-411-recap-4-27-2021

 

Hates Children

  • Asking a Hates Children Sim to ‘Try For Baby’ has no chance of success unless the Sim is Dazed.

https://simsvip.com/2021/04/29/the-sims-4-official-sims-411-recap/

 

Removing it from your 411 notes doesn't remove it from the game.
